HT Leads, I would go to Renault for.. although the king lead is sold separately, you'll have to ask for that too.. at least you know the quality if getting OE:
http://renaultpartsdirect.co.uk/products/Renault-Clio-Williams-Plug-Lead-Set.html

dizzy and rotor arm are not available from Renault anymore, so a product from a factors like so, I got these a couple weeks back:
http://www.ebay.co.uk/itm/Distributor-Cap-Rotor-Arm-Set-for-Renault-Clio-1991-1998-/371081260887?pt=UK_CarsParts_Vehicles_CarParts_SM&hash=item56662aaf57

As for plugs.. NGK, will be fine the ones you'll want are BKR6EK.
